This is why you never want to tell them you’re paying cash when making a deal. This is not illegal. They don’t like cash they’re expecting to make money off you in the long run with a FAT loan so they’re going to want to change the price for a cash deal.

I’d negotiate those fees. Idk where you’re from but all states have different rules for the doc Fee if they give you issues then tell them to take the money out of the MSRP of the vehicle.

Is this illegal? by EVOSexyBeast in whatcarshouldIbuy

[–]BootyMaster24 2 points3 points  (0 children)

It’s just another bs way to make money off you. Believe it or not I’ve seen doc fees at $1500. Some states don’t have regulations on doc fees so a dealer can charge what they want.

Do I get a 2016 Camaro 2SS or a G70 3.3t 2019-2021 by Distinct_Equal_9490 in camaro

[–]BootyMaster24 0 points1 point  (0 children)

You’re kind of asking for a lot for 25k what is speed to you? What type of HP are you looking for.

The G70 if you’re finding it for that price seems like a good choice though idk about reliability I would do more research on that.

Another really good and I would say safe choice would be a used Hyundai Sonata N-line it has a very nice interior for the price and respectable power though it’s spins the wheels a lot at lower speeds. I would test drive one and see if you like it they are very nice. Also one of Hyundais full N cars like the Elantra, Veloster, and Kona N those are going to be way more sporty and be able to put the power down better but have less luxury and probably be closer to 30k.

If you can find a V6 Camaro with a 10 speed In that price range those are going to be pretty quick too.

Would also look into a Mazda 3 turbo. Pretty nice looking car with more luxurious interior and some power to it but not as sporty as the other options.

Do I get a 2016 Camaro 2SS or a G70 3.3t 2019-2021 by Distinct_Equal_9490 in camaro

[–]BootyMaster24 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I’ll just say this don’t get a 2016 automatic they are known to have this transition shutter issue it’ll just be a headache to deal with. If you are going to look for a Camaro look for a 10 speed I believe those are 2019 and up its going to be more expensive but you don’t want to be screwed with that transmission issue look it up.
